Johnson v. Patten, 224 Ill. App. 640 (1922)

Feb. 14, 1922 · Illinois Appellate Court · Gen. No. 26,436
224 Ill. App. 640

W. D. Johnson, appellant, v. Frank C. Patten and T. T. Watson, appellees.

Gen. No. 26,436.

Trespass on the case for damages for fraudulently inducing plaintiff to loan money to defendants on inadequate security. Judgment for defendants. Appeal from the Circuit Court of Cook eounty; the Hon. Thomas G. Windes, Judge, presiding. Heard in the Branch, Appellate Court at the October term, 1920.

Reversed and remanded.

Opinion filed February 14, 1922.

Russell G. Watters, for appellant. George W. Brown, for appellant Frank C. Patten.
